Context for the broader area surrounding STILLHOUSE, sourced from the federal Recreation.gov rec-area record.
Historical sites include the Stage Coach Inn in nearby Salado. Stillhouse Hollow Lake is located near the Fort Hood Army Base, which has several points of interest for the military buff. Tour Chalk Ride Falls Environmental Learning Center located below Stillhouse Hollow Dam. The Center includes a hiking trail along the Lampasas River, a spring-fed creek with a waterfall, and several wildlife viewing points.
From Belton, 5 miles southwest on US 190, 4 miles left on FM 1670.

Best season: spring. Spring offers the best balance of mild weather and active lake life — daytime highs are commonly in the mid-60s to low-80s°F (mid-March through May), with cool, pleasant nights. Wildflowers and budding trees brighten the shoreline, bass and sunfish are in prime spawning condition for excellent fishing, and migratory songbirds return, making birding and wildlife viewing especially rewarding. The boat ramp access hours are 6 a.m. to 8 p.m. The day use hours are 8 a.m. to 8 p.m.
